Full job description

About Limbic

Limbic is the leading clinical AI company for mental healthcare and the largest deployment of patient-facing mental health AI in the world. Our technology has supported over half a million patients across the UK and US, helping health systems deliver higher-quality, more accessible, and more efficient care.

We regulated the first AI diagnostic model for adult mental health as a Class IIa medical device. We’ve published in top-tier journals, won major awards, and advise governments and regulators globally on AI safety, medical devices, and the future of clinical agentic systems.

About the Role

We are looking for an experienced peer support specialist to join our team as an independent contractor (1099). You will use your lived experience to motivate patients and build trust within an AI-led therapy program. This role requires being a steady, human presence for others, especially when navigating technological challenges. This fully virtual position offers the flexibility to design a schedule that works for you.

We are building a team to reach patients who have been underserved by traditional systems, including older adults, rural residents, and people from marginalized backgrounds whose identities deserve genuine understanding.

  • Position Type: 1099 Independent Contractor

  • Location: Fully remote / Telehealth

  • Schedule: Flexible within clinic hours (Monday-Friday 9:00-5:00pm EST)

  • Compensation: Fee-for-service

    • Each session, inclusive of documentation and required administration, is paid at $10 (estimated session length 20-30 minutes).

    • Training on Limbic systems, essential training to ensure patient safety, and coordination meetings are paid at $20/hour, prorated.

    • Paid no-show fee, reflecting the documentation, patient outreach, and scheduling work required regardless of session attendance.

Core Responsibilities

  • Individual Support: Deliver peer sessions that normalize challenges, instill hope, and reinforce therapeutic progress.

  • Patient-Centered Motivation: Meet individuals where they are, helping those who feel hesitant find their own internal reasons for engagement.

  • Group Sessions: Lead virtual groups focused on wellbeing tools and psycho-education.

  • Escalation: Follow crisis protocols to assess safety and initiate clinical handoffs to psychotherapists when necessary.

Note: Maintaining boundaries and scope of practice is vital. You will never be asked to perform clinical duties or therapy that requires a professional license.

Who We Need

  • Credentialing: A current and unrestricted peer support certification (e.g., CPS-MH or state equivalent). Certified Older Adult Peer Specialist (COAPS) or Digital Certified Older Adult Peer Support Specialists (D-COAPS) a plus.

  • Lived Experience: Personal history of anxiety and/or depression that you can leverage to instill hope. Health-tech experience is a plus.

  • Inclusivity: An authentic commitment to meeting every patient with curiosity and respect, ensuring those from marginalized backgrounds feel genuinely seen.

  • Older Adults: A strong interest in supporting adults 65+ with patience and awareness of their unique medical and generational needs.

  • Facilitation: Experience leading peer or educational groups is a plus.

  • Tech Aptitude: Comfort with digital platforms and a methodical approach to troubleshooting hiccups with patience.

  • Candidates must have regular access to a private computer/laptop and high-speed internet access while conducting sessions

  • Candidates must have a private space to make calls to patients where they will not be overheard.

  • Experience in mental health coaching a plus.

What We Offer

  • Paid training, meetings, and no show fees.

  • Flexible, remote schedule within clinic hours (Monday-Friday 9:00-5:00pm EST)

  • The chance to collaborate with experts and shape the future of AI in mental healthcare.

  • A supportive clinical environment with direct access to supervision during business hours.

  • Optional (unpaid) case-consultation meetings to meet with the broader team and supervisors.

  • Optional (unpaid) training provided by clinical staff to enhance your skills as a PSS.

  • A culture that values autonomy, integrity, and your unique lived experience.

Our Hiring Process

We use a structured hiring process to remain efficient and fair. This includes application screening, a take home project (1-1.5 hours), a live clinical interview to evaluate judgment and inclusivity, and a reference check. You will need to pass a background check for this role.

We envisage a world where the highest quality mental healthcare is available to everyone, everywhere. To get here, we use our unfair advantage in AI to solve the catastrophic supply-demand imbalance in mental healthcare. We come from neuroscience, machine learning, software engineering and psychology. Together, we're empowering patients and clinicians to tackle the leading cause of disability worldwide.
